Noodle automatic detection weighing and sorting device
Technical Field
The utility model relates to the technical field of automation, in particular to an automatic noodle detecting, weighing and sorting device.
Background
The weighing and sorting device can be applied to automatic weight detection on various automatic production lines and logistics conveying lines, and is widely applied to the on-line detection industry of industries such as pharmacy, food, toys, hardware, chemical industry, auto parts and the like.
The existing weighing and sorting device can generate a lot of dust during working, the dust on a conveyor belt can affect the quality and efficiency of weighing and sorting along with long-time accumulation, and because the weighing and sorting device is not provided with a cleaning device, workers are often required to clean the surface of the conveyor belt by using cleaning cloth when cleaning the conveyor belt, but the cleaning cloth is easily rolled into a conveyor during cleaning, damage to a machine and damage to the safety of the workers are easily caused, so the utility model provides the automatic noodle detecting, weighing and sorting device, and the problems are solved.

Both sides of the upper end of the first conveying frame 1 are connected with limiting plates 16, and the limiting plates 16 are used for sorting the randomly placed objects on the first conveying frame 1.
A photo detector 17 is mounted on the second carriage 2, the effect of the photo detector 17 being to register each passing article.
The other side of the upper end of the third conveyor 3 is provided with a collecting box 18, and the collecting box 18 is used for collecting articles with insufficient weight.
The lower end of the supporting rod is connected with a universal wheel 19, and the universal wheel 19 is used for facilitating movement of the weighing and sorting device.
Specifically, when the utility model is used, a worker firstly moves the weighing and sorting device to a designated position through the universal wheel 19, the worker respectively starts the first conveyor 1, the second conveyor 2 and the third conveyor 3, so that the first conveyor 1, the second conveyor 2 and the third conveyor 3 run synchronously, the worker sequentially places the segmented noodles on the conveyor belt 5 of the first conveyor 1, the noodles which are randomly placed are sorted through the limiting plates 16 on the two sides of the upper end of the first conveyor 1, the sorted noodles can be moved from the first conveyor 1 to the second conveyor 2, the noodles on the second conveyor 2 are weighed one by one through the cooperation of the weight sensor 6 arranged in the second conveyor 2 and the photoelectric detector 17 arranged on the upper end of the second conveyor 2, and the weighed noodles are recorded and displayed by a display 8 arranged on one side of the second conveyor 2, so that after the noodles are moved from the second conveyor 2 to the third conveyor 3, the sorting machine 7 on one side of the third conveyor 3 pushes the noodles with insufficient weight into a collecting box 18 on the other side of the upper end of the third conveyor 3 through the sorting machine 7 by the weight of each noodle in the display 8, so that the noodles with sufficient weight can be packaged, but with long-term use of the weighing and sorting device, residues generated by the noodles are easily adhered to the conveyor belt 5 and cannot be separated from the conveyor belt 5 together with the noodles, so that the weight and efficiency of weighing and sorting can be influenced by the residues of the noodles on the conveyor belt 5, a worker sleeves the roller brush 14 on the rotating rod 11, then rotates the rotating rod 11 provided with the roller brush 14 into a groove of the U-shaped block 13 through the hinged connection piece 10, and the U-shaped block 13 rotates through the bearing 12 to prevent the roller brush 14 from being thrown away by the conveyor belt 5 during operation, so that the conveyor belt 5 can be cleaned through the roller brush 14.
